IP查询
查询
你查询的IP:[121.76.2.220] 地理位置:中国–上海–上海东方有线
最新查询
114.64.129.255
121.76.136.208
123.138.185.241
120.128.33.67
202.38.111.95
118.178.197.234
119.112.108.162
124.200.68.48
211.64.29.211
121.76.2.220
202.46.32.247
120.72.32.32
220.160.68.83
117.103.16.127
162.105.167.173
203.91.120.94
203.176.168.226
221.224.87.207
218.16.100.119
117.53.176.241
203.142.219.139
117.124.231.181
125.112.69.188
218.16.218.68
116.207.193.189
210.16.128.144
203.209.224.38
203.80.144.190
58.240.113.75
119.28.161.223
60.108.227.57